1 votos

¿Cómo asegurar que dalvik-cache y lib están vinculados a la SD en el arranque?

Recientemente, he actualizado mi htc-desire con una tarjeta SD más grande con una partición de 512Mo en ella.

He instalado enlace2sd para colocar las aplicaciones en la tarjeta SD ext4 partición.

Luego tuve que crear a mano, el mount script para que mi partición fuera utilizada por enlace2sd . (seguramente debido al acceso de escritura en /system montaje)

Lo que me pregunto es si hay una forma de asegurar que al reiniciar, las aplicaciones vinculadas creen su dalvik-cache directamente en la SD. Lo que sucede en el arranque es que tengo que abrir enlace2sd seleccionar todas mis aplicaciones y volver a vincular todo.

¿Es una característica incluida en el montaje script?

¿O es simplemente la forma enlace2sd ¿funciona?

PD: lo que es molesto es que el dalvik-cache ocupa demasiado lugar y puede impedir que alguna aplicación se inicie correctamente.

1voto

Izzy Puntos 45544

Es poco probable que sea posible en este contexto, ya que la caché de Dalvik tiene una ubicación fija en todo el sistema ( /data/dalvik-cache ). Así que no se puede tener "lugar de aplicaciones vinculadas su caché dalvik directamente en la SD". O todo o nada. Echa un vistazo a la app2sd etiqueta-wiki de enfoques alternativos que permitan avanzar todo el dalvik caché a su tarjeta SD. Pero un movimiento selectivo IMHO es imposible.

Observación: Una excepción a esta regla general son las ROMs odexadas, en las que el .odex archivos se encuentran en el mismo lugar que la aplicación, al menos para aplicaciones del sistema . Así que hay puede ser una forma de hacer lo mismo para las "aplicaciones de usuario" que he echado en falta).

PreguntAndroid.com

PreguntAndroid es una comunidad de usuarios de Android en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X